1.68 Cloaks (http://nwn.bioware.com//forums/viewpost.html?topic=494920&post=4293048&forum=42&highlight=)
<hr />My only problem is Clothing Dye seems to do nothing to change the color of them, im all for cloaks but those default tan ones are so not my color.<hr />Cloaks use colors from all palettes (leather, metal, cloth), so it really depends on the type of cloak which effect a dye has.

More: <hr />It seems that dyeing in cloak does not work if the module uses the CEP. At least my customize character hak has the same problem if a module uses the CEP.<hr />Let me state that very clearly:

Like with every patch, CEP IS NOT COMPATIBLE WITH 1.68 UNTIL UPDATED. THINGS WILL BREAK, NOT WORK, LOOK FUNNY AND SO ON IF YOU ARE USING CEP.

Once CEP has been updated by the Community, these problems should go away.

More: Just to note - we have never been able to reproduce reported crashes linked to the HotU animations and without being able to make them happen, we can't fix them.

If someone has a *reliable* way of reproducing it that doesn't require a huge team to work on and hours of time (because we don't have either for NWN), make sure to send it to nwbugs@bioware.com.

<font size="3" face="Verdana, Arial" color="#cc6600">Brian Chung, Technical Artist</font>

NWN 1.68 Glow / Mouseover Glitch (a.k.a. 'Glowing Mystery Tails')? (http://nwn.bioware.com//forums/viewpost.html?topic=495149&post=4292991&forum=42&highlight=)
Looks like the glow is picking up the invisible cloak bones that are part of the animation supermodel.
